7. What supplies are supported?
Visit www.zebra.com for a listing of supplies that will be supported with the
S4M printer. Since the S4M printer supports both 1” and 3” cored media,
existing supplies can be used.
8. What are the connectivity options available on the S4M?
The S4M printer will come standard with Parallel, Serial and a USB
connection. The options include internal ZebraNet PrintServer 10/100baseT
Ethernet and a ZebraNet PrintServer Wireless connection.
9. How much memory is standard on the S4M?
The S4M comes with 8MB DRAM and 4MB flash standard, with an optional
64MB Flash upgrade. The 64MB option is a factory only option and must be
selected when ordering. There is no PCMCIA or compact flash card in the
S4M printer.
10. I have a Direct Thermal version of the S4M, can I upgrade to the Direct
Thermal/Thermal Transfer version?
The Thermal Transfer option must be configured at the time of ordering the
printer. There is no field or factory upgrade to the full thermal transfer version
of the printer.
